Washington Commanders running back Brian Robinson Jr. had a disappointing showing against the Chicago Bears in Week 8. This was his lowest fantasy output of the season, as he totaled just 65 rushing yards and 11 receiving yards off one reception. This was the first time this season that the Alabama product failed to score double-digit PPR points. Despite the struggles this afternoon, fantasy managers should continue to view the 25-year-old as a high-end RB2 playing on a potent Washington offense. Next weekend, he will face the New York Giants, who have allowed the 14th-fewest PPR points to opposing running backs.

Cleveland Browns running back Jerome Ford (hamstring) was ruled out for Week 8 according to Scott Petrak of The Chronicle Telegram. Ford was able to return to practice on Friday after sitting out on Wednesday and Thursday but did not progress enough to suit up this weekend. As a result, Ford will now set his sights on returning to action in Week 9 against the Los Angeles Chargers. As a result, fantasy managers should expect Nick Chubb to operate as the lead runner against the Baltimore Ravens with Pierre Strong Jr. serving as the No.2 option.
